Pleomorphic Implications in Gastrointestinal Stromal Tumors

Summary
Minimally invasive surgery for incidental gastrointestinal stromal tumors (GISTs) is common. Careful review of pathology, including mitotic rate and dedifferentiation, is crucial for determining appropriate patient surveillance after GIST resection.

Background:
- Minimally invasive partial gastrectomies for incidentally discovered gastrointestinal stromal tumors (GISTs) are increasingly prevalent.
- Surgical resection, particularly wedge resection, is technically straightforward for most GISTs.
- Standard surveillance protocols for GISTs are evolving with better understanding of tumor biology.
Purpose of the Study:
- To discuss the management of a patient with a pleomorphic gastric GIST.
- To highlight the importance of integrating pathology findings with clinical management for GIST surveillance.
- To emphasize the role of subtle pathological features in altering postoperative surveillance strategies.
Main Methods:
- A case report of a patient with a pleomorphic gastric GIST treated with wedge resection.
- Review of the patient's pathology, focusing on mitotic rate, pleomorphism, and dedifferentiation.
- Discussion of surveillance interval determination based on pathological findings and multidisciplinary consultation.
Main Results:
- The patient's pleomorphic gastric GIST was successfully resected via wedge resection.
- The resected GIST, despite being pleomorphic, did not exhibit dedifferentiation.
- A longer surveillance interval was deemed appropriate due to the absence of dedifferentiation.
Conclusions:
- Surgical resection of incidentally found GISTs is generally well-tolerated.
- Pathological features such as mitotic rate and dedifferentiation significantly influence postoperative surveillance recommendations for GISTs.
- Close collaboration between surgical and oncology teams is essential for optimizing GIST patient care and surveillance.
